Exactly How bid Bonds Operate In Construction Projects
In building and construction tasks, recognizing just how bid bonds feature is important for both professionals and task proprietors. a bid bond acts as a warranty that you, as a service provider, will certainly meet your contract obligations if granted the job.
When you send a bid, you include the bid bond, usually a percentage of your bid quantity. If you win the agreement and fall short to continue, the job proprietor can declare the bond quantity, compensating them for the loss.
This process helps make sure that you're serious about your proposal and have the economic capacity to finish the job. By needing bid bonds, proprietors can secure their passions and advertise liability among professionals, fostering a more reliable bidding process atmosphere.
